Barium is not poisonous in the form of its sulfate. That's because barium sulfate is insoluble in water. Unless a barium compound dissolves with the subsequent release of barium ions, it is not going to be highly toxic.

Ammonium sulfate reacts with barium nitrate to form ammonium nitrate and barium sulfate. (NH4)2SO4 + Ba(NO3)2 ==> 2NH4NO3 + BaSO4 It is a double replacement reaction. that is the correct answer
Barium sulfate is very sparingly soluble. Any addition of it to a solution containing sulfate or barium will almost immediately cause a precipitate to form.
